Lola T70: the Iconic Racer Returns With a Modern Twist

The Revival of a Legend The storied history of the Lola T70 is about to be rekindled as the iconic racer makes a comeback, thanks to the rejuvenated Lola Cars. Originally dominating the 1960s sportscar scene, the T70 clinched victories in the Can-Am Championship and the Daytona 24 Hours, solidifying its place in racing lore. […]

Corvette’s E-Ray Bows Out as Grand Sport X Roars In

The End of the E-Ray Era The Chevrolet Corvette E-Ray has officially reached the end of the line, with production winding down in 2026. This hybrid supercar, which launched in 2024, struggled to maintain momentum, with production numbers plummeting from 3,153 units in its first full year to a mere 816 units in its final […]
